How To Choose The Right Betta Fish Bowls

Size Shapes Daily Care

Tank volume is the first thing to weigh because small bowls fill up visually faster than they fill up in actual water space. A 1-gallon bowl like Anchor Hocking or LAQUAL works for a simple display, while 2.4 to 2.5 gallons from Vehipa or NICREW gives you more room for water stability and layout planning.

Smaller setups look tidy, but they also leave less margin for error and less room for décor. That’s why a compact bowl can suit a desk, while a slightly larger nano tank often fits a more committed setup.

Material Changes The Feel

Glass and acrylic each bring a different experience. Glass, like Anchor Hocking, Craftsboys, and LAQUAL, usually feels more traditional and visually crisp, while acrylic, like PRUGNA, is lighter and easier to manage on a wall mount.

That trade-off matters during cleaning and placement. Glass tends to feel sturdier in hand, but acrylic can make sense where weight and mounting matter more than a classic look.

Filtration And Light Add Convenience

Built-in filtration, such as in AQUANEAT, NICREW, Craftsboys, and Vehipa, helps a setup feel more complete and can reduce how often you need to do routine maintenance. LED lighting, found on AQUANEAT and Craftsboys, also improves visibility and makes décor stand out in a dim room.

The catch is that each added feature brings another part to manage. A plain bowl asks for fewer pieces, while a feature-rich tank usually rewards you with a smoother day-to-day routine.

Decor Should Fit The Tank, Not Crowd It

Decor matters in betta bowls because hiding spots and visual structure can make a tiny space feel calmer. Pieces like CousDUoBe or LAQUAL add shape without turning the tank into clutter, which is the point when space is tight.

What looks good in a product photo can feel crowded in person, so a compact layout usually works better than filling every corner. Start with the tank size you have, then let décor support it rather than take over.

What To Weigh Before You Choose

Hidden Buying Traps

Small tanks often look simpler than they are, and that can trip up first-time shoppers. A tiny bowl with no filter or light can still work as a display, but it asks for more hands-on care and gives you less room to correct layout mistakes.

Another common miss is buying décor that looks generous in the photos but feels oversized in the tank. In a one-gallon bowl, less usually looks better and leaves more usable space.
